Transaction f517c87877ce33b9166160e895edbfd237569c4b700835a38a2776897508207e
1 Input
2 Outputs
- f517c87877ce33b9166160e895edbfd237569c4b700835a38a2776897508207e:0
- f517c87877ce33b9166160e895edbfd237569c4b700835a38a2776897508207e:1
value 2846746
address 1MAQWSbYRyw9KwpcYYQrDUVrPa8gntRBSQ
value 76088254
address 1JAjn89rpCZzgU12eFrCpE4tgY3NesJxdh